πField Visit Update!
As MUPHYSA, we had an amazing experience visiting UTH, RPA, and NISIR , learning a lot about the practical side of medical physics and radiation safety πβοΈ
We got to see the progress on the new bunkers being built at UTH, and the installation of advanced medical equipment that will soon enhance diagnostic and treatment services in Zambia πΏπ²πͺπ½
It was a day full of learning, exposure, and inspiration , a true reminder of why medical physics is vital to our nationβs healthcare system.

Cyclotrons help fight cancer every day.
They produce targeted radioactive drugs that let doctors deliver radiation directly to cancer cells while minimizing harm to healthy tissue.
This method, known as targeted radionuclide therapy, is a safe, precise and non-invasive cancer treatment.
